"It will come about in that day," declares the Lord God, "that I will make the sun go down at noon and make the earth dark in broad daylight."  Amos 8:9  written 750 b.c.



It was the third hour when they crucified him.  The written notice of the charge against him read:  The King of the Jews.  They crucified two robbers with him, one on his right and one on his left.  Mark 15:25-27

From the sixth hour until the ninth hour, darkness came over all the land.  Matthew 27:45

It was now about the sixth hour and darkness came over the whole land until the ninth hour, for the sun stopped shining and the curtain of the temple was torn in two.  Luke 23:44-45

At the ninth hour, Jesus cried out in a loud voice, "Eloi, Eloi, lama sabachthani?" which means, "My God, my God, why have you forsaken me?"  Mark 15:34

During this point in history, the day started at six in the morning.  Therefore, the sixth hour was twelve noon.  Jesus hung on a cross for six hours so you could be reconciled to the Father.
